Kraljevci, Ruma
Kraljevci (Serbian Cyrillic: Краљевци) is a village in Serbia. It is situated in the Ruma municipality, in the Srem District, Vojvodina province. The village has a Serb ethnic majority and its population numbering 1,232 people (2002 census).

Name
The name of the town in Serbian is in the plural, and therefore it is grammatically correct to refer to it as "Kraljevci are" instead of "Kraljevci is". A hypothetical singular version of the name would be Kraljevac.
